Discover Melbourne's Famous Laneways and Urban Art

How does one truly capture the essence of Melbourne? The city's iconic laneways serve as vibrant canvases that reflect its eclectic spirit. Hidden from the bustling streets, these narrow passages are adorned with striking murals and intricate graffiti, showcasing the work of local and international artists. Hosier Lane, perhaps the most famous, draws art enthusiasts who marvel at its ever-evolving display of creativity. The atmosphere is alive with a sense of discovery, where each corner reveals new artistic expressions and stories.

As visitors wander through these laneways, the fusion of urban culture and art becomes unmistakable. Boutique shops and cafés hidden throughout this labyrinth invite visitors to pause and soak in the atmosphere. From imaginative stencil work to large-scale installations, Melbourne's thriving street art culture not only enriches the visual landscape but also captures the city's dynamic character, making it a must-have experience for anyone exploring Melbourne.

Discover the Best of Melbourne's Markets and Food Scene

Melbourne's vibrant laneways seamlessly lead visitors to an equally enchanting experience: its thriving markets and varied culinary landscape. The city offers a rich tapestry of flavors, from the celebrated Queen Victoria Market, where fresh produce and gourmet delights abound, to the eclectic South Melbourne Market, known for its artisanal goods and international cuisine. Here, visitors can indulge in a variety of treats ranging from freshly baked pastries to traditional Vietnamese pho.

The food truck culture adds to the excitement, with various vendors operating their stalls throughout the city, serving up creative dishes that capture the multicultural spirit of Melbourne. Local food festivals frequently celebrate the rich culinary diversity, showcasing local chefs and their signature dishes.

For those seeking unique souvenirs, venues such as the Rose Street Artists' Market showcase local artistry, presenting artisan-made jewelry and creative pieces. Exploring Melbourne's markets and food scene not only delights the senses but also connects visitors with the city's dynamic community spirit.

Relax in Melbourne's Stunning Beautiful Parks and Gardens

Nestled amidst the urban landscape, guests can discover tranquil hideaways in Melbourne's thriving green spaces. These natural havens provide a revitalizing contrast to the bustling city life. Royal Botanic Gardens, with its sprawling grounds and varied botanical displays, welcomes relaxed walks and tranquil picnics. Fitzroy Gardens, known for its historic features and winding paths, offers a scenic backdrop for both families and couples.

Albert Park, known for its picturesque lake, makes an excellent destination for outdoor activities including jogging, cycling, or leisurely relaxation by the water. Nearby, Carlton Gardens displays the splendor of Victorian-era landscaping, adorned with impressive fountains and historically significant buildings. For those seeking tranquility, the quiet corners of Princes Park offer a retreat from the city's hustle and bustle. Melbourne's parks and gardens not only elevate the city's visual appeal but also function as vital areas for leisure and relaxation.

Cultural Festivals Year-Round

Why is Melbourne considered a haven for culture lovers? Melbourne plays host to a diverse range of lively festivals year-round, showcasing its rich heritage and artistic diversity. From the Melbourne International Comedy Festival, which draws humor lovers from around the globe, to the Melbourne International Film Festival, spotlighting outstanding cinematic achievements, every visitor will find an event to enjoy. Melbourne's beloved Moomba Festival showcases community pride through parades and aquatic activities, while White Night transforms the streets into an immersive art experience. Additionally, the Australian Music Week showcases emerging artists across various genres. These events reflect Melbourne's dynamic cultural landscape, encouraging both residents and tourists to participate in the city's creative endeavors and communal festivities. Melbourne truly embodies a year-round celebration of culture.

Exhilarating Outdoor Adventures in Melbourne: From Beaches to Hiking Trails

Melbourne boasts a wealth of exhilarating outdoor experiences that appeal to every type of explorer, from beach lovers to nature lovers. The city's stunning beaches, such as St Kilda and Brighton, offer plenty of options for swimming, sunbathing, and water sports. Guests can delight in beautiful walks along the beach or treat themselves to charming beachside cafes.

For nature lovers who seek the serenity of the wilderness, the close by Dandenong Ranges provides a number of hiking trails that meander through verdant bushland and offer stunning views. The 1000 Steps Kokoda Track is particularly popular among hikers, testing them through its demanding climb and rich history.

Additionally, thrill-seekers can discover the Yarra River via kayaking or biking along its beautiful riverside paths. Whether resting on the riverbank or heading out on a stimulating trail, Melbourne's scenic landscape ensures an unforgettable experience for those in pursuit of outdoor excitement.

Celebrated Local Restaurants

As tourists navigate the lively avenues of this iconic Australian destination, they rapidly realize that its culinary scene is as diverse as its culture. Iconic local restaurants such as Attica and Flower Drum reflect Melbourne's celebrated status in the world of inventive dining. Attica, famous for its exceptional use of indigenous Australian flavors, provides an extraordinary dining occasion that captivates food lovers internationally. At the same time, Flower Drum serves refined Cantonese cuisine within a sophisticated atmosphere, cementing its place as an essential stop for lovers of authentic cuisine. For a more casual experience, the celebrated Chin Chin offers flavorful Southeast Asian-inspired creations, buzzing with energy. Each restaurant not only highlights exceptional culinary skills but also reflects Melbourne's multicultural essence, ensuring that every meal becomes a cherished memory woven into the city's character.

What Is the Ideal Time to Visit Melbourne?

The best time to visit Melbourne is during spring (September to November) and autumn (March to May). These seasons offer mild weather, vibrant festivals, and fewer crowds, enhancing the overall experience for travelers exploring the city.

What Are the Best Ways to Get Around Melbourne?

Navigating the city is easiest by utilizing the comprehensive transit system, featuring trams, trains, and buses. Alternatively, cycling or strolling through the foot-traffic-friendly streets offers a scenic and enjoyable experience for discovering the city.

What Family-Friendly Activities Are Available in Melbourne?

Yes, there are many kid-friendly things to do accessible, including interactive museums, zoos, and parks. Visitors with families can delight in outdoor picnics, cultural festivals, and various attractions that accommodate the whole family, ensuring unforgettable memories for the whole family.

What Are the Best Local Foods to Try in Melbourne?

Local dishes to try include the beloved meat pie, delectable dim sims, fresh seafood, and the renowned Melbourne coffee. These gastronomic delights showcase the city's multicultural heritage and dynamic culinary landscape, satisfying every taste preference.

How Safe Is Melbourne for Solo Travelers?

Melbourne is generally safe for solo travelers, offering a vibrant atmosphere and friendly locals. Nevertheless, as with any city, it's advisable to stay aware of surroundings and follow basic safety precautions during outings.
